What exactly do they need?
The Bureau of Prisons needs a small business to provide food service items for FCI Gilmer, including dairy and bread deliveries weekly for the quarter. The amounts requested for milk and bread are only estimates for the quarter.
What's the contract structure and timeline?
This is a combined synopsis/solicitation for a total small business set-aside. The contract will be awarded by line item to responsive/responsible vendors whose offer conforms to the solicitation and is considered most advantageous to the government. The contract will be for a quarter, with deliveries expected from July 1, 2026, through July 31, 2026.
How will they pick the winner?
The government will consider past performance approximately equal in value to price. The award will be acceptance of the offer, and all requirements must be satisfied in terms of quantity required, delivery dates, specifications, packaging, labeling, and invoicing procedures.
